I heard someone say, “I am wishing Mitch McConnell an unhappy birthday.” We may not like a person’s way of thinking and acting, but this gives us no right to wish unhappiness on anyone, even your worst enemy. We are called on to lighten peoples’ burdens and make it easier for people to be good. We are to “make our enemies our friends.” What we are asking our government to do we ourselves must do first. If we want the government to change, we must change first. Change comes from the bottom, not the top. Somehow people have this false notion that the more violence you do to someone the better your chances are of changing the person. I find the opposite is true. The better I treat someone the better chance there is that the person will do better. “ You get more flies with a spoonful of sugar than you do with a barrel full of vinegar.’ If we want a nonviolent world, we must learn to be nonviolent. If we want justice in the world we must learn to be just with others. If we do not want war, we must be committed to refusing to go to war and refusing to pay for it. ---Don Timmerman

We watched Israeli soldiers and border police as they confiscated a mobile classroom in the Palestinian village of Susiya, The soldiers arrived shortly after the start of the school day, and children crowded into the village’s small school and watched as the soldiers loaded the mobile classroom onto a flatbed truck after throwing desks, chairs and equipment in a pile in a muddy field in the rain. Border police arrested one Palestinian man who was protesting the theft of the classroom. Some weeks ago soldiers also confiscated a tractor from Susiya which was being used to create a level surface for a playground for the students. ---Cassandra Dixon of Mary House Catholic Worker in Wisconsin Dells WI
